Comparison to Surrounding Areas
The median household income ($78,750) for 97722 is more than 97721 ($76,250), 97736 ($-1), and Harney County ($55,208).
| 97722 | $78,750 |
| Harney County | $55,208 |

The average household income ($78,593) for 97722 is less than the average household income for 97721 ($91,559) and 97736 ($120,090). But it's more than Harney County ($77,287).
| 97722 | $78,593 |
| Harney County | $77,287 |

The per-capita income for 97722 is $26,632. The per capita income ($26,632) for 97722 is less than 97721 ($41,363), 97736 ($28,903), and Harney County ($33,321).
| 97722 | $26,632 |
| Harney County | $33,321 |

0% of households make over $200,000 a year. The percent high income households (0.0%) for 97722 is less than 97721 (5.1%), 97736 (20.0%), and Harney County (6.5%).
| 97722 | 0.0% |
| Harney County | 6.5% |

All income statistics above are the most current, comparable income statistics available from the US Census Bureau and are from the American Community Survey 2024 5-year estimates. You can find this information and other demographics for 97722 on the US Census Bureau’s website. These values are in 2024 inflation-adjusted dollars and were downloaded on 29 January 2026.
